Transaction 34016f81c31027e3927438148e14d031814c0ee52768e4d8342704cf62fc24f8
1 Input
1 Output
-
34016f81c31027e3927438148e14d031814c0ee52768e4d8342704cf62fc24f8:0
- value
- 8194291
- script pubkey
- OP_0 OP_PUSHBYTES_20 f6a48609ba23a96aa364f02c2ca66f34e6a2bf28
- address
- bc1q76jgvzd6yw5k4gmy7qkzefn0xnn290eglyf3u5